It’s that time of year again. City Manager Frank Boyles tells us he needs more money to manage the city, and if he doesn’t get it, one of the possible cost-cutting options he offered is closing the library.
Who’s kidding whom? It’s a county library where the county pays for books, supplies and salaries, not the city. And with Mayor Ken Hedberg asking for a tax levy increase, one might assume that the city is broke. Maybe it’s time to review the city’s financial documents.
